Mall of America® celebrates Black Friday by bringing back the nostalgia of doorbuster deals in an exciting and fun way

Giving away incredible prizes with a total value of more than $100,000

BLOOMINGTON, MN — November 14, 2023

Mall of America® is gearing up for another successful Black Friday shopping experience for guests to enjoy. In the spirit of the holidays, Mall of America will continue its tradition of closing on Thanksgiving. The Mall will re-open its doors on Black Friday at 7 a.m. to a line of thousands of excited shoppers ready to take advantage of unbelievable deals, win exceptional prizes, and create lasting memories. This year, the Mall is featuring a playful twist on Black Friday Doorbusters, but in a larger-than-life way.

“Black Friday has evolved through the years, but many of us remember the heyday of Black Friday doorbusters,” said Jill Renslow, Chief Business Development & Marketing Officer at Mall of America. “To bring back the doorbuster excitement, we created a one-of-a-kind Black Friday activation with must-have prizes that guests have to see to believe. Watching the fun and magic of the season come to life at Mall of America is amazing, as our visitors light up with joy from our beautiful décor, festive events, and best-in-class shopping. We have welcomed nearly 20 new brands so far this year, and we have an additional 10 openings during the holiday season for our shoppers to enjoy. We are excited for them to experience their first Black Friday at Mall of America.”

Our Black Friday prizes are back by popular demand! As guests come through the North Entrance doors on Black Friday, 4,000 visitors will be given one of our coveted Black Friday Mystery Cards that will reveal what prize is in store for them and where they will receive it. They will either be directed to pick up their prize at one of our retailers, or they will be sent to the gold redemption center for a prize valued between $20 to $250. The big winners will head to our exciting new Doorbuster Zone! At the Doorbuster Zone, guests will get to select their designated doorbuster to bust through a physical door to retrieve the guests’ prize valued between $250 to nearly $600. From local celebrities to characters from across the galaxy, the designated doorbusters are sure to help lucky guests get into the holiday spirit like never before. 

The first 200 people in line at the North Entrance of the Mall on Black Friday will receive a $25 Mall of America gift card in addition to their Mystery Card. Plus, one lucky winner within the first 200 guests will be the WONDEROUS WONKA WINNER. This winner will receive a $2,500 gift card courtesy of the film WONKA, in theatres on December 15.

ABOUT MALL OF AMERICA

At 5.6 million square feet, Mall of America is the largest shopping and entertainment complex in North America with up to 520 world-class retail stores and restaurants; Nickelodeon Universe, a 7-acre indoor theme park; SEA LIFE Minnesota Aquarium; FlyOver America; Crayola Experience; and more. The Mall opened in 1992 and is located in Bloomington, Minn., minutes from downtown Minneapolis and St. Paul and adjacent to MSP International Airport.
